Abstract
In this paper, an AC small-signal equivalent circuit model of continuous conduction mode (CCM) ZSI based on state space averaging is presented. The AC small-signal model includes the dynamics of ZSI introduced by the inductors and capacitors contained in the ZSI circuit, providing guidelines to the system control design. In addition, a novel modified space vector PWM is presented to distribute the shoot-through states into the zero vectors without compromise to the active space vector. Simulation results based on the design are presented, using the proposed SVPWM control strategy
